A popular hiking trail in New York’s Adirondack Mountains has been closed for over a month due to a bull moose displaying “unusual behaviors.” The New York State Department of Environmental Conservation suspects the moose may have an underlying illness and continues to monitor its condition while keeping the trail closed for safety.
